5. Pricing

Pricing constitutes a fundamental consideration within the “parker boat dealer near me” search paradigm. It directly influences the purchasing decision, necessitating a nuanced understanding of various factors that contribute to the final cost.

  • Base Price and Options

    The manufacturer’s suggested retail price (MSRP) serves as a starting point, but the ultimate price is determined by optional features and upgrades selected by the buyer. For example, a base model Parker boat may be significantly less expensive than one equipped with advanced navigation systems, upgraded upholstery, and a more powerful engine. Discrepancies in option pricing across different dealers can impact the overall affordability and perceived value.

  • Dealer Markups and Negotiation

    Dealers apply markups to the base price and options, reflecting their operational costs and profit margins. The degree to which these markups are negotiable varies depending on market conditions, dealer policies, and the buyer’s negotiation skills. A proactive buyer may secure a lower price by comparing quotes from multiple “parker boat dealer near me” results and leveraging competitive offers.

  • Taxes, Fees, and Registration

    Beyond the boat’s price, buyers must account for applicable sales taxes, documentation fees, and state registration costs. These ancillary charges can add a substantial sum to the total expense. The specific rates and fees vary by location, underscoring the importance of considering the dealer’s geographical context within the “parker boat dealer near me” search.

  • Financing Options and Interest Rates

    Many buyers rely on financing to purchase a Parker boat. The interest rate and terms of the loan significantly affect the total cost of ownership. Dealer-provided financing options may offer convenience, but it’s prudent to compare rates from external lenders to ensure competitive terms. Higher interest rates translate into a higher overall price, making this a critical aspect of the “parker boat dealer near me” price comparison.

In summary, the “Pricing” component associated with locating a “parker boat dealer near me” is multifaceted. Prudent buyers must carefully evaluate the base price, options, dealer markups, ancillary charges, and financing options to arrive at a comprehensive understanding of the total cost. Comparing prices and financing terms across multiple local dealers identified through the search enhances the likelihood of securing a favorable deal.

Frequently Asked Questions

The following questions and answers address common inquiries regarding the process of finding an authorized Parker boat dealer within a specific geographical area.

Question 1: What defines an “authorized” Parker boat dealer?

An authorized dealer is a retailer formally recognized by Parker Boats to sell its products. These dealers undergo specific training and adhere to Parker’s standards for sales, service, and customer support. Purchasing from an authorized dealer ensures the validity of the manufacturer’s warranty.

Question 2: How can the authenticity of a “parker boat dealer near me” search result be verified?

The official Parker Boats website maintains a directory of authorized dealers. Cross-referencing search results with this directory confirms legitimacy. Contacting Parker Boats directly to verify a dealer’s authorization status provides an additional layer of assurance.

Question 3: What recourse exists if a dispute arises with a local Parker boat dealer?

Initially, direct communication with the dealer is recommended to resolve the issue. If a resolution cannot be achieved, contacting Parker Boats’ customer service department may be necessary. Legal options should be considered as a last resort.

Question 4: Does geographical proximity guarantee superior service or pricing?

While proximity offers convenience, it does not automatically translate to better service or lower prices. Factors such as dealer reputation, inventory, and individual business practices also play a significant role. Comprehensive research beyond location is advisable.

Question 5: How frequently is the online information regarding “parker boat dealer near me” updated?

The accuracy and timeliness of online information vary. While search engines and online directories strive for accuracy, dealer information may change frequently. Direct verification with the dealer is recommended to confirm current inventory, pricing, and contact details.

Question 6: Are “parker boat dealer near me” search results influenced by advertising or sponsored listings?

Search results may be influenced by advertising and sponsored listings. These paid placements are typically denoted as such. It is crucial to distinguish between organic search results and paid advertisements when evaluating potential dealers.

Navigating a Local Parker Boat Dealer Visit

A purposeful visit to a dealer identified through a “parker boat dealer near me” search requires careful planning to maximize the effectiveness of the interaction. Diligent preparation allows for efficient evaluation of available options and informed decision-making.

Tip 1: Define Specific Boating Needs. Prior to the visit, determine the intended use of the boat. Consider factors such as frequency of use, passenger capacity, and preferred boating activities (fishing, cruising, watersports). This focused approach allows the dealer to recommend appropriate Parker boat models and configurations.

Tip 2: Research Available Parker Boat Models. Familiarize oneself with the range of Parker boat models offered. Review specifications, features, and available options on the Parker Boats website. This preliminary research enables a more informed discussion with the dealer regarding suitability and customization possibilities.

Tip 3: Establish a Realistic Budget. Determine a realistic budget that encompasses not only the boat’s purchase price but also associated costs such as taxes, registration fees, insurance, and potential maintenance expenses. This financial framework will guide the selection process and prevent overspending.

Tip 4: Prepare a List of Questions. Compile a list of specific questions regarding boat features, performance, warranty coverage, financing options, and service availability. A prepared question set ensures all critical information is obtained during the dealer visit.

Tip 5: Schedule an Appointment in Advance. Contact the dealer to schedule an appointment, particularly if seeking a demonstration or test drive. Advance scheduling ensures dedicated attention from a sales representative and avoids potential wait times.

Tip 6: Request a Sea Trial, if Feasible. Whenever possible, arrange for a sea trial of the desired Parker boat model. Experiencing the boat firsthand provides valuable insight into its handling, performance, and overall suitability for intended use. It is advisable to request that this happen.

Tip 7: Document All Interactions. Maintain detailed records of all communications with the dealer, including quotes, agreements, and warranty information. This documentation serves as a reference point and protects against potential misunderstandings.

Engaging in these preparatory steps ensures a productive and informative visit to a local Parker boat dealer, ultimately contributing to a satisfactory purchasing outcome.
